

With heartfelt sorrow and deep love, we announce the passing of Donald William Erdman, who entered eternal rest on July 27, 2025, at the age of 88. He was a devoted husband, loving father, proud veteran, and a friend to many. Born on January 9, 1937, in Hackensack, New Jersey, Don was the beloved son of the late Arthur and Mildred Erdman. He honorably served in the United States Army, a reflection of his lifelong dedication to service, strength, and integrity. Don was the loving husband of Thordis A. Erdman, with whom he shared 53 wonderful years of marriage. Together, they built a home filled with love, laughter, and lasting memories. He was a proud and supportive father to his children, Donald W. Erdman II and Bryce Erdman, who continue to honor his legacy with love and pride. Don lived life with joy and enthusiasm. He was an avid golfer, a talented pool shark, and a skilled poker player who always appreciated good competition and great company. He also loved board games, and his playful spirit brought warmth to every gathering. As a proud member of the Orange Park Elks Lodge #2605, Don found community and camaraderie among friends who became like family. He will be remembered for his kindness, his quick wit, his steady presence, and the love he gave so freely. Don’s life was a blessing to all who knew him, and his memory will live on in the hearts of those he touched.
A Celebration of Life will be held on Thursday, August 14, 2025, at 11:00 AM at Hardage-Giddens Holly Hill Funeral Home, 3601 Old Jennings Road, Middleburg, Florida 32068. Burial will follow immediately at Holly Hill Memorial Park, at the same location.
